The bomb essay

Ann Hulbert writes at Slate about the renewed emphasis on the personal statement in college applications.

No wonder essay-crafting services and even summer camps, as the Wall Street Journal recently reported, are catching on among an affluent clientele. Everyone’s trying to come up with what College Summit calls the “bomb essay.”

Previously, Edward Humes shares an essay about this annual season of student angst, “The Real You in 750 Words.”
